Default another 4+3 od question

My 88 4+3 will not come out of od by pushing the button. When I put it into first gear it does automatically come out of od. When I kick it, it comes out of od and works normally and shifts back into od when I back off, as it should. Fluids are normal. Wiring looks good and plug ins are tight. Any ideas ? Clearly the computer has control over it. So the relay works, and the connector at it works.

The shifter switch sends a signal to the ECM, not the relay. That circuit is bad. Most likely on the shifter itself. You have to pull the center console plate to get to it, it's on the side of the shifter below the leather boot.

If the switch is bad, it's cheap. I forget the source though.

When you go to take the shift **** off and the switch out, be sure to lay a cloth around the shift rod so that any tiny parts (jumpimg springs) cannot fall into the shift linkage tunnel. Otherwise, it is real hard to retrieve them. Don't ask how I know.
